Grub prevention and control are essential for securing yards from the damage caused by beetle larvae eating grassroots. Early detection is essential-- signs include brown spots that raise quickly from the soil or an increase in birds and other wildlife digging for grubs. Preventive treatments, applied at the correct time in the grub life process, can considerably decrease infestations These treatments might be chemical or biological, such as helpful nematodes that naturally minimize grub populations. For active invasions, alleviative items can be used, though they are most effective when grubs are little and actively feeding. A proactive technique, consisting of proper lawn upkeep, aeration, and overseeding, helps in reducing the likelihood of extreme grub issues. Healthy yards recuperate faster from damage and are less susceptible to recurring invasions.
